SYD-ARN QF/TG/AY one way Business from $2684 AUD

Anyone wanting a European One way ?
Books into I for QF, AY and Z for TG. I in Qf earns lots of miles on Alaska Mileage Plan.
Plenty of availability from September to November and then from Late January 2023

Originally Posted by MaxVO
Alaska cheats! Getting any partner mile credits with them is like having your teeth pooled without anesthetic.
I can’t believe that this happened to someone else, lol. I did a British Airways first ticket which credited 450% to Alaska. Luckily I had a photo of the boarding pass and it was all resolved. Now I always make it a point to take a photo of the boarding pass with seat number and record locator.
